What Our Shingle, Tile & Metal Roofing Service Includes
Shingle Roofing
Asphalt shingles remain the most common roofing choice in Miami’s residential neighborhoods like Kendall, Cutler Bay, and Palmetto Bay, and for good reason: they’re cost-effective, fast to install, and the newer architectural lines hold up to wind far better than the three-tab shingles of twenty years ago. We install architectural and dimensional shingles rated for Miami-Dade’s High Velocity Hurricane Zone requirements, which means the nails, underlayment, and edge details all meet the stricter code South Florida demands. A shingle roof installed correctly in Miami should last 20 to 25 years, but only if the decking, flashing, and ventilation are addressed at the same time - we don’t shortcut any of those steps.

Tile Roofing
Clay and concrete tile roofs are the signature look of Miami architecture, from Coral Gables Shingle, Tile & Metal Roofing Spanish colonials to Doral’s newer Mediterranean-style communities. Tile is heavy, permanent-feeling, and excellent in the heat - but improperly fastened tiles become projectiles in a tropical storm. Winslow Windows & Doors handles both full tile roof replacement and repairs: cracked barrel tiles, slipped pieces, failed underlayment beneath the tile, and re-bedding ridge caps after years of storm cycles. We match barrel, flat, and S-tile profiles so a repaired section disappears into the original roofline.

Metal Roofing
Standing-seam and corrugated metal roofing has moved from commercial buildings into Miami’s residential mainstream because it shrugs off wind, reflects heat, and can last 40 to 50 years with minimal maintenance. Metal is also the lightest of the three systems, which means less structural load on older Miami homes that weren’t engineered for heavy tile. We install concealed-fastener standing seam, exposed-fastener panels, and metal shingle profiles, all with the high-temp underlayment and uplift-rated fastening patterns Miami-Dade code requires. For homeowners tired of replacing shingles every two decades, metal is often the last roof they’ll ever buy.

Signs You Need Shingle, Tile & Metal Roofing Right Now
- Granules in your gutters or at downspout bases. Shingle granules are a roof’s first line of defense against UV, and when they start washing away, the asphalt beneath is exposed and degrading. If you see dark grit accumulating after rain, your shingles are past their midpoint and accelerating toward leaks.
- Water stains on ceilings or upper walls after afternoon storms. Many Miami homeowners only discover a roof leak during the wet season, when a slow puncture finally shows itself as a brown ring on drywall. By the time you see it inside, the roof decking may have been wet for weeks.
- Cracked, slipped, or missing tiles visible from the ground. A single broken tile exposes the underlayment below, and once that barrier is compromised, water travels laterally under healthy-looking tile. On barrel tile roofs especially, one visible crack often means several others nearby are fractured but still seated.
- Daylight visible through the roof deck from the attic. If you can see sunlight pinholes through roof sheathing, water is getting in whenever it rains. Metal roofs can also develop this at old fastener penetrations or seams that have worked loose over decades of thermal movement.
- Roof age over 20 years for shingles, 30 for metal, or 35 for properly-maintained tile. Even a roof that looks fine from the street is living on borrowed time once it passes its expected service life. A proactive replacement before failure is always cheaper than emergency repairs after water has damaged insulation, drywall, and framing.

How Much Does Shingle, Tile & Metal Roofing Cost in Miami?
Here in Miami, a full asphalt shingle roof replacement on a typical 1,800-square-foot single-story home generally runs $8,500 to $14,000, with architectural shingles at the higher end of that range. Concrete or clay tile replacement on the same footprint typically lands between $22,000 and $38,000, depending on tile profile, whether the underlayment needs full replacement, and the roof’s complexity. Standing-seam metal roofs in Miami run roughly $18,000 to $32,000 for that same home size, with the premium over shingles offset by a service life twice as long. What moves the price: roof pitch and accessibility, the number of penetrations (vents, skylights, chimneys), whether existing decking is sound or needs sections replaced, and whether we’re tearing off one layer or two. How to avoid overpaying: get a written line-item quote, not a lump sum; confirm the quote includes permit fees and disposal; and ask whether the company is using Miami-Dade compliant underlayment and fasteners.
